Channel 4 has always been a patron of amazing Irish comedy. It is, after all, the home of
Father Ted, one of the most iconic television shows Ireland has ever produced and still an inspiration to Irish writers, comics and performers over 25 years after it first aired.
It should come as no surprise then that the channel is once again championing an exciting Irish comedy export in the form of
Frank of Ireland, a new sitcom centred around a layabout thirty-something year old named Frank and his intellectually challenged best friend, appropriately named Doofus.
